Output 6423639f667deeb9d5c6ee97330fefcd2d0a193c78106a604f58860abdbf778a:1

value
1616405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 956d17ecc0b39ec58652810ac1695562cc8c9b78 OP_EQUAL
address
3FK7J5AsT5YzQyZSvTbSnt3QterCgo6m2f
transaction
6423639f667deeb9d5c6ee97330fefcd2d0a193c78106a604f58860abdbf778a
spent
true